Japan's Cigarette Tax May Be Increased

Packages of cigarettes are displayed on a vending machine in Tokyo, Japan, on Friday, Dec. 11, 2009. Yoshiyasu Okihira, an analyst at Credit Suisse, said on Dec. 4 he expects the Japanese government to raise tobacco taxes by 40-60 yen a pack after a media report by the Mainichi Daily News.
